Malaga in American English
a large, white, oval table grape, grown esp. in California
seaport in S Spain, on the Mediterranean: pop. 532,000
noun: a strong, sweet dessert wine with a pronounced muscat grape flavor, esp. that produced in Málaga, Spain

Málaga in British English
noun: a port and resort in S Spain, in Andalusia on the Mediterranean. Pop: 547 105 (2003 est)
